Context & Background
Born on February 14, 1992, Christian Eriksen has spent over a decade at the absolute pinnacle of European football. He first garnered global attention as a teenage prodigy at the Ajax youth academy, making his professional debut in 2010. His clinical passing and spatial awareness quickly made him one of Europe's most sought-after prospects.
In 2013, Eriksen made a high-profile move to Tottenham Hotspur in the English Premier League. Over seven seasons in London, he established himself as one of the league's premier creators, guiding Spurs to the 2019 UEFA Champions League final. He later joined Inter Milan, where he secured a Serie A Scudetto under Antonio Conte.
Eriksen's career and life faced an unprecedented challenge during the UEFA Euro 2020 tournament in 2021, when he suffered a cardiac arrest on the pitch. Following his recovery and the implantation of an ICD (Implantable Cardioverter-Defibrillator), his return to professional football was nothing short of miraculous. Successful stints at Brentford and Manchester United proved that his vision, technique, and tactical intelligence remained entirely world-class.
Impact & Utility
The enduring curiosity surrounding christian eriksen age highlights a broader trend in modern football: the evolution of the aging playmaker. At 34 years old, Eriksen has successfully adapted his game to compensate for a natural decline in raw physical speed.
- Positional Shift: Much like Andrea Pirlo or Luka Modrić in their later careers, Eriksen has increasingly operated as a deep-lying playmaker, utilizing his exceptional passing range to dictate the tempo of matches from deeper midfield zones.
- Set-Piece Mastery: His delivery from free-kicks and corners remains highly lethal, offering clubs a consistent attacking threat regardless of his open-play running statistics.
- Mentorship & Leadership: Beyond his on-pitch contributions, Eriksen provides invaluable dressing room leadership for both his club and the Denmark national team, guiding the next generation of midfield talents.
